Vintage Coach Musette Value Guide (Style 9269): What It’s Worth

The Musette is the vintage Coach crossbody a lot of buyers are actually looking for without knowing its name: a small, flat flap bag on a long adjustable strap, built for hands-free everyday carry. That practical shape — plus its glove-tanned leather and turnlock or buckle closure — makes it one of the steadiest sellers in the 1990s crossbody segment.

Typical resale value

Vintage Coach Musette bags in good condition typically sell for $50–$150. The compact everyday shape has broad appeal, so clean examples in classic colors move quickly.

Condition Typical range What buyers expect
Excellent / near-unused $110–$150 Supple leather, clean flap edges, un-cracked strap, working hardware
Good (normal wear) $70–$110 Light corner and edge wear, honest patina
Fair / project $35–$70 Dry leather or a strap that needs conditioning or replacement

How to identify and date it

The Musette is a small structured flap crossbody — think of it as a scaled-down messenger. Style number 9269 appears in the creed code; sizes and strap drops vary slightly across production years. Most examples fall in the 1990s, decodable from the Letter-Number-Letter–Number creed format. Confirm yours with the Creed Decoder.

Because “Musette” is also a generic bag term, double-check the creed style number rather than relying on a seller’s title — a style number that matches the silhouette is your best confirmation, as covered in the authentication checklist.

What drives the price

The strap is the make-or-break detail on any crossbody, and the Musette is no exception: a long, thin adjustable strap is the first thing to dry and crack, and an intact one adds real value. Color drives the rest — black and British Tan are the safe sellers, while the compact size makes brighter colors pop with buyers who want a small statement crossbody. Complete, un-repaired hardware rounds out a top-of-range example.

Buying and selling tips

The Musette sits in the sweet spot for practical daily use, so emphasize wearability when selling — measure the strap drop and show the bag worn if you can.
